Understanding Unity’s 3D Modeling Capabilities
Before we dive into the process of creating 3D models in Unity, it’s important to understand its capabilities. Unity supports a range of file formats for 3D modeling, including .obj, .fbx, and .dae. This means you can import models created in popular 3D modeling software such as Blender, Maya, and 3ds Max into Unity.
Once you have your model imported, you can use Unity’s built-in tools to manipulate it further. These tools include scaling, rotation, translation, and mesh editing, among others. Additionally, Unity offers a range of assets and plugins that can help enhance the appearance of your 3D models, including textures, lighting, and particle effects.
The Importance of Proper Modeling Techniques
Creating 3D models in Unity requires proper modeling techniques to ensure they look realistic and function correctly within the game. Some key tips to keep in mind include:
- Keep it simple: Don’t overcomplicate your model with unnecessary details that could slow down performance or make it difficult to animate. Stick to the essentials and focus on creating a clean, polished look.
- Use layers: Use layers to organize your model and make it easier to edit individual parts. This can also help with animation and other effects.
- Optimize for performance: Pay attention to the number of polygons in your model and use tools like Unity’s mesh optimizer to reduce the overall file size without sacrificing quality.
- Test frequently: As you create your 3D models, test them regularly to ensure they’re functioning correctly within the game. This can help catch any issues early on and avoid costly mistakes later in development.
